Converters

Roman Numeral Converter | Convert Numbers to Ancient Numerals


Roman Numeral Converter

Convert numbers to Roman numerals and back. Valid range for numbers: 1–3999.


Notes
  • Standard modern Roman rules used (I=1, V=5, X=10, L=50, C=100, D=500, M=1000).
  • Subtractive notation supported (IV, IX, XL, XC, CD, CM).
  • Number input limited to 1–3999 (traditional modern range).

Roman Numeral Converter – Easily Change Numbers to Ancient Numerals

Ever wondered why movie sequels often use Roman numerals, like Rocky IV or Super Bowl LVII? Or maybe you’ve looked at the date carved on an old building and struggled to figure out what it meant. Roman numerals may be ancient, but they are still everywhere today. That’s where a Roman Numeral Converter comes in handy. With it, you can quickly change any number into Roman numerals, or take a Roman numeral and turn it back into a regular number you recognize.


Why Roman Numerals Still Matter

Even though we use Arabic numbers (1, 2, 3…) in everyday life, Roman numerals are far from obsolete. You’ll still find them:

  • On clocks and watches with traditional faces.
  • In book chapters, outlines, or film sequels.
  • On certificates, monuments, and official documents.
  • In sports, such as the Olympic Games or the Super Bowl.

Being able to read and convert them not only prevents confusion but also adds a touch of cultural knowledge and fun.


What You Enter in the Converter

The converter works in two directions:

  • Number → Roman: Enter a whole number (1–3999) and get the Roman numeral version.
  • Roman → Number: Enter a Roman numeral (I, V, X, L, C, D, M) and see its numeric value.

This range is important: the standard Roman numeral system only supports numbers from 1 to 3999 (after that, special overlines are needed, which most modern systems don’t use).


The Rules of Roman Numerals

Roman numerals use seven main letters:

  • I = 1
  • V = 5
  • X = 10
  • L = 50
  • C = 100
  • D = 500
  • M = 1000

They follow some straightforward rules:

  1. Additive rule: Write largest to smallest, then add. Example: VIII = 5 + 1 + 1 + 1 = 8.
  2. Subtractive rule: A smaller number before a bigger one means subtraction. Example: IV = 4, IX = 9, CM = 900.
  3. Repetition rule: I, X, C, and M can be repeated up to three times. But V, L, and D cannot repeat.

Formula Behind the Conversion

When turning a number into Roman numerals, the system checks the number against a descending value chart:

  • 1000 → M
  • 900 → CM
  • 500 → D
  • 400 → CD
  • 100 → C
  • 90 → XC
  • 50 → L
  • 40 → XL
  • 10 → X
  • 9 → IX
  • 5 → V
  • 4 → IV
  • 1 → I

It subtracts and adds these values step by step until the whole number is converted.

Example: 1984 → MCMLXXXIV

  • 1000 = M
  • 900 = CM
  • 50 = L
  • 30 = XXX
  • 4 = IV

How the Converter Works

Converting a number into Roman numerals

  1. Enter a number between 1 and 3999.
  2. The tool matches your number against the value table above.
  3. It subtracts values and builds the numeral string.
  4. Your result is shown instantly.

Converting Roman numerals back to numbers

  1. Enter the Roman numeral letters.
  2. The tool validates your input (no invalid combos like IC or VV).
  3. It scans left to right, adding or subtracting values.
  4. The total is displayed as a regular number.

❓ Frequently Asked Questions – Roman Numerals Converter

3999 (MMMCMXCIX) under standard rules.
That’s a stylistic choice called “watchmaker’s four,” though IV is the official form.
No. The Romans had no symbol for zero.
No, the system only works with positive integers.
Yes, input is case-insensitive. Output is always uppercase.
Yes: 2025 = MMXXV.
The subtractive rule is used to keep numerals shorter and standard.
Yes, many publishers and academics rely on Roman numerals for prefaces, chapters, or outlines.
Historically, yes (with overlines), but this converter follows the modern 1–3999 range.
The tool will give an error message explaining why it’s not valid.